Understanding Balloon Payments
So, what exactly is a balloon payment? Simply put, it's a type of financing where you make lower monthly payments for a set period, but then you're faced with a large, one-time payment at the end of the loan term. Think of it like this: you're only paying off a portion of the car's value each month, and the remaining chunk is saved for that final “balloon” payment. This can be super appealing because those initial monthly payments can be significantly lower than with a traditional auto loan. Imagine snagging that awesome Toyota Tacoma you've been eyeing, but paying less each month compared to a standard financing plan! However, it's crucial to understand the full picture before jumping in. That balloon payment can be a doozy if you're not prepared. It could be a significant percentage of the car's original price, so you need a solid plan for how you'll handle it when the time comes. Many folks consider refinancing the balloon payment, which means taking out another loan to cover that large sum. Others might trade in the vehicle and use the equity to pay it off. It really boils down to your financial situation and how well you can strategize for the future. It’s essential to weigh the pros and cons carefully. Sure, lower monthly payments sound fantastic, but you don't want to be caught off guard when that balloon payment suddenly appears. Make sure you fully grasp the terms and conditions, and honestly assess whether you’ll be able to manage that final, larger payment. Benefits of a Balloon Payment at OSC Toyota SC
Okay, let’s talk about the upsides of opting for a balloon payment, especially when you're getting your Toyota from OSC Toyota SC. The most obvious advantage is those lower monthly payments. This can free up your cash flow, allowing you to allocate funds to other important things like paying down debt, investing, or even just enjoying life a little more! Imagine having extra money each month to pursue your hobbies or take that vacation you've been dreaming of, all while driving a brand-new Toyota. Another potential benefit is the opportunity to drive a nicer car than you might otherwise be able to afford. Because the monthly payments are lower, you could potentially upgrade to a higher trim level or a more feature-rich model. That means you could be cruising around in a Toyota 4Runner with all the bells and whistles, even if your budget is usually more suited for a Corolla. Furthermore, a balloon payment can be a strategic move if you anticipate your financial situation improving in the near future. For example, if you're expecting a promotion, a bonus, or another significant increase in income, you might be confident in your ability to handle the balloon payment when it comes due. However, it's crucial to be realistic about your prospects and not rely on overly optimistic assumptions. Things don't always go according to plan, so it's always best to have a backup strategy. And finally, for some individuals and businesses, balloon payments can offer tax advantages. Be sure to consult with a tax professional to determine if this applies to your specific circumstances. They can help you understand how a balloon payment might affect your tax liability and whether it aligns with your overall financial goals.
Potential Drawbacks of Balloon Payments
Alright, now for the not-so-fun part: the potential downsides of balloon payments. It's super important to be aware of these before you sign on the dotted line at OSC Toyota SC. The biggest concern, of course, is that large balloon payment looming at the end of the loan term. This can be a major financial burden if you're not prepared. Imagine getting close to the end of your loan and realizing you have no way to cover that huge payment! It can cause a lot of stress and potentially damage your credit score. Another potential drawback is the risk of depreciation. Cars are notorious for losing value quickly, especially in the first few years.
